Massmutual's rating is influenced by a number of factors, including its financial strength, customer satisfaction, claims processing, and management practices. A company's financial strength is perhaps the most important factor in determining its rating. This includes factors like capitalization, liquidity, and investment performance. Customer satisfaction and claims processing are also important, as they reflect how well the company is meeting the needs of its policyholders. Management practices, such as risk management and strategic planning, are also considered when evaluating an insurer's rating.The Role of Financial Stability in Massmutual's Rating
Financial stability is critical for any insurer, but it's especially important for life insurers. Life insurance policies can last for decades, and policyholders need to know that their insurer will be able to meet its obligations over the long term. Massmutual's strong financial position gives policyholders confidence that their coverage will remain in force and that their beneficiaries will receive the promised benefits.Massmutual's Track Record for Customer Satisfaction and Claims Processing

1. What is MassMutual Life Insurance's rating?
MassMutual has received high ratings from several independent rating agencies, including A.M. Best, Moody's, and Standard & Poor's. These ratings reflect the company's financial strength and stability, as well as their ability to pay claims.
2. How does MassMutual's rating compare to other insurers?
MassMutual's ratings are generally in line with other top insurers in the industry. They have consistently received high marks for financial stability and claims-paying ability.
3. Does MassMutual's rating affect my policy?
The rating of your insurer can have an impact on your policy in a few ways. For example, if the insurer were to experience financial difficulties, it could potentially affect their ability to pay claims. However, MassMutual's strong ratings suggest that this is unlikely to be a problem.
4. Should I choose MassMutual based solely on their rating?
While MassMutual's rating is certainly an important factor to consider, it should not be the only one. You should also consider factors such as the type of policy you need, the coverage amount, and the cost of the policy. Additionally, you may want to read reviews or talk to a licensed insurance agent to get a better sense of the company's overall reputation.
In conclusion, MassMutual Life Insurance has a strong rating from independent rating agencies, which suggests that they are a reliable and stable insurer. However, when choosing a policy, it's important to consider a variety of factors in addition to the rating.
